Using Emojis in Your Social Media Posts

Emojis are a great addition to your social media posts. Here are just a few of the benefits:
  • They can get a lot more engagement than just traditional text
  • They make you seem a little more fun and relatable!
  • They can also highlight particular points of your message
  • Draw more attention to some of the components of your post
  • Add value and engagement to your posts

I think it's important to realize that lots of big brands, not even just veterinary industry, are using emojis in their social media marketing. Just since 2016, we have seen a nearly 800% increase in emoji use across marketing efforts, including social media.

So we're gonna talk a little bit more about actually how to add them and how to integrate those into your posts. I do wanna make a point that, you know, they're not for, for everything, right? So there's a time and a place for them in which they're gonna be appropriate. Kind of like the hash tag thing, you don't wanna go overboard. You don't wanna use hundreds of emojis in every post 'cause people will think that's annoying. But try to use them sparingly and where they're appropriate.

You've probably noticed that I use them quite frequently, mostly for fun. But I do use them especially if I'm sharing large blocks of text. You know, if I have a post that has a lot of information, and I wanna break that up, or I wanna have bullet points Instead of the, just the dash is all you can do most of the time on social media posts, I'll use an emoji. It doesn't even have to be one of the cutesy ones, like an animal one.  I do sometimes use the emojis that are like the blue diamond as a bullet point or something like that. But of course, everybody loves using the animal emojis because they're awesome, right? So, we're gonna talk about how you can actually do that, but just keep that in mind. Try to use them when they're appropriate, use them sparingly, but definitely start incorporating them into some of your social media posts.

You can add emojis to your posts four ways: 
1. From your mobile device: emojis are automatically integrated with your keyboard!
2. From your PC: access the on-screen touch keyboard, available in Windows 8.1 and higher. Right click in your bottom toolbar, click on toolbars, find your keyboard, and then you'll see an emoji in the lower left hand corner. Unfortunately in my experience, this doesn't give you ALL of the emojis, but it's a start. 
3. From your Mac: Press Command, Control and the spacebar down all at the same time to open up your emoji keyboard. 
4. Using Emojipedia.com: That's like the coolest word I've ever said in a professional sense, right? So emojipedia.com is a free website and you can actually go there to search all the emojis and learn all their history, which is crazy. These are all the emojis that are standardized-- approved by the Unicode Standard, (which is apparently like the governing body of emojis. So, how do I get to be on that board? 'Cause that sounds like fun. I want that job). But anyway, so you can go there, find all the emojis that you're used to and integrate them super easy and super quick.
